Distributed Denial of Service (DDoS) Attacks

Distributed Denial oc Service (DDoS) attacks disrupt financial services by overwhelming servers . These attacks flood systems with traffic, rendering them inaccessible. The impact can be severe, leading to lost revenue and damaged reputation. Key effects include:

  • Service outages
  • Increased operational costs
  • Customer dissatisfaction
  • Mitigating DDoS attacks requires robust security measures. Effective strategies include traffic filtering and rate limiting. Awareness is essential for prevention. Every organization should prepare for potential threats.

    Firewalls and Intrusion Detection Systems

    Firewalls and intrusion detection systems (IDS) are essential components of cybersecurity. Firewalls act as barriers between trusted networks and potential threats. They filter incoming and outgoing traffic based on predetermined security rules. This helps prevent unauthorized access. Intrusion detection systems monitor network traffic for suspicious activities. They provide alerts when potential breaches occur. Timely responses can mitigate damage. Together, these technologies enhance overall security posture. A layered approach is most effective. Security is a continuous process.

    Encryption Techniques for Data Protection

    Encryption techniques are vital for data protection in finance. They convert sensitive information into unreadable formats, ensuring confidentiality. Common methods include symmetric and asymmetric encryption. Symmetric encryption uses a single key for both encryption and decryption. In contrast, asymmetric encryption employs a pair of keys. This enhances security for transactions. Additionally, encryption at rest and in transit is crucial. Protecting data during storage and transmission is essential. Awareness of encryption standards is necessary. Security is paramount in financial operations.

    Key Regulatory Bodies and Their Roles

    Key regulatory bodies play vital roles in maintaining financial stability. The Securities and Exchange Commission (SEC) oversees securities markets and protects investors. Its primary goal is to ensure transparency and fairness. The Financial Industry Regulatory Authority (FINRA) regulates brokerage firms and exchange markets. It enforces compliance with industry standards. Additionally, the Federal Reserve monitors monetary policy and banking institutions. This helps maintain economic stability. Each body has specific mandates that contribute to overall market integrity. Awareness of their functions is essential for compliance. Knowledge fosters a culture of accountability.
